A user interface element factory is registered for a set of three properties.

  • Typea string that identifies a type of a user interface element.
  • Namea string that identifies a single user interface element within a type class.
  • Modulea string that identifies a single module of OpenOffice.
    • A combination of these three property values can uniquely identify every user interface element within OpenOffice. Currently the following user interface element types are defined:
      • menubar
      • popupmenu
      • toolbar
      • statusbar
      • floater
